
The number of unfair labor practice (ULP) charges filed with the National Labor Relations Board (NLRB or Board) by workers and their union representatives has increased by 30% over the last two years, according to NLRB enforcement data. The 19,869 ULP charges filed in FY 2023 are the highest number of charges filed since FY 2016. The NLRB’s annual enforcement numbers over the last ten years show a clear correlation between Democratic-appointed Board majorities, which tend to be more union-friendly, and Republican-appointed Board majorities, which tend to be more management-friendly.
